Sunny Thursday in Bulgaria, But Clouds and Winds Loom in the Mountains
On Thursday, Bulgaria will experience predominantly sunny weather across most regions
The weather will remain warmer than usual today. Clouds will be variable, more significant in the morning hours, but the chance of precipitation is small, and after midday it will decrease to mostly sunny weather from the west.
The wind throughout the country will be oriented from the north-northeast, it will be weak. Temperatures will slightly decrease, but will remain higher than usual for October: the minimum will be between 12°C and 17°C, and the maximum - between 24°C and 29°C.
Cloudiness over the Black Sea will be variable, decreasing towards the end of the day to negligible. A light wind will blow from the north-northeast. Maximum temperatures: 23-25°C. The temperature of the sea water is 19-21°C. The excitement of the sea will be 1-2 points.
Clouds over the mountains will be variable, reducing after noon to mostly sunny weather. It will blow to a moderate north-westerly, sometimes strong south-westerly wind, which will turn from the west after noon. Maximum temperature at an altitude of 1200 meters is about 20°C, at 2000 meters - about 11°C.
